The majestic 1913 colorado street bridge in pasadena, california not only wowed early travelers crossing the causeway but soon took on a more sinister note when people began to leap from the 150-foot bridge to their death. Within a decade of its construction, locals had begun to call it the “suicide bridge,” and as you can imagine, legends began to abound that the bridge was haunted be those unfortunate souls.

Seaford or woodland residents know all about delaware’s most haunted road – a short bridge on route that’s known locally as maggie’s bridge. According to local legend, a young woman named maggie bloxom was decapitated in an accident on this bridge in the late 19th century. To convince you further, a local cemetery has maggie bloxom’s grave, and she did die young.
